Sailrite is seeking a Backend Engineer to design, develop, and maintain critical services that connect core platforms like NetSuite, BigCommerce, and Directus, ensuring an efficient, reliable, and scalable technology ecosystem.
Requirements
- Strong proficiency in a backend programming language, with a primary requirement for Go (Golang).
- Solid experience building and consuming RESTful APIs and a deep understanding of web service architecture.
- Strong understanding of SQL and experience with relational databases (e.g., PostgreSQL, MySQL).
- Demonstrable experience with the principles of system integration and connecting disparate business applications (e.g., ERP, e-commerce, CRM).
- Experience with an iPaaS platform like Boomi is a major plus.
- Direct API integration experience with NetSuite, BigCommerce, and/or Directus.
- Familiarity with front-end technologies like HTMX for building simple, effective internal tools.
Responsibilities
- Design, develop, and maintain high-quality, reusable backend services, primarily using Go (Golang) and HTMX, to support business-critical functions.
- Build and optimize data pipelines and ETL processes.
- Write efficient SQL queries and contribute to the performance and design of our application databases.
- Diagnose and resolve complex issues within our backend systems and integrations, performing root cause analysis to prevent future occurrences.
- Work closely with the team to define technical requirements and produce clear, concise documentation for the services and systems you build.
Other
- Proven experience as a Backend Engineer, Software Engineer, or a similar development-focused role.
- Applicants must be currently authorized to work in the United States on a full-time basis.
- Onsite position, remote work not available.